So, what can you do to make things better?

Tip #1:

STOP TAKING IN INFORMATION

You need to stop confusing yourself.

Tip #2:

TALK TO YOURSELF.Play out a conversation.

Tip #21/2:

ASK YOURSELF QUESTIONS.Throw yourself a curve ball.

Tip #3:

THE SIXTY SECOND RULE.Stop ‘thinking’ about it.

Tip #4:

VOTE.Majority wins.

Tip #5:

Prioritize, divide, and conquer.Get the low hanging fruits and create quick wins.

Tip #6:

BUILD THE ’T’.Weigh the pros and cons.

Tip #7:

MAP YOUR THOUGHTS.Visual helps.
